The Benefits of a Folding Mobility Scooter

A folding mobility scooter is designed to be simple to transport and to store. They can fold down to a size that is smaller than a briefcase, and can be put away in closets, trunks or other small spaces.

veleco-faster-4-wheeled-mobility-scooter-fully-assembled-and-ready-to-use-safe-and-stable-alarm-spacious-storage-cupholder-blue-296.jpgMany also meet the requirements of airlines for luggage, which opens the possibility of travel and new experiences. This guide will explore the many benefits of a folding scooter and how they can improve lifestyles dramatically.

When comparing models, be sure to pay attention to their overall length as well as their width and height when folded. This information will help determine if the scooter is a good fit for your home and car. Ideally, you want the unit to be small enough that it can easily be stored in the trunk of your car, or even inside a closet for convenient storage when not in use.

The type of battery the scooter uses is also important. Certain models are powered by lithium batteries while others utilize sealed lead acid batteries. If you're considering buying one, the latter option isn't as reliable. Instead, opt for models powered by lithium batteries.

Convenient Storage

Foldable scooters are easily folded to fit into the trunk of a car, or other storage spaces. They are light and easy to carry over long distances. In addition, these mobility scooters come with convenient features like a LED headlight and taillights to ensure that you are able to safely drive on any road or path.

Consider the length as well as the height and width of the scooter when deciding one. Also, be aware of its top speed. This is essential when you plan to use your scooter while driving or traveling. Certain models come with an option to control the remote that allows you to fold and unfold your scooter from a distance. This feature is a great alternative for those with weak physical strength or mobility.

Most folding scooters will require maintenance in the same way as other mobility scooters. Regular maintenance will help prolong the lifespan of your folding scooter and ensure it is running smoothly. You should regularly check for the presence of debris on the mechanical components of your scooter, specifically around the latches and hinges that allow the scooter to fold and unfold. Cleaning these areas is a good idea every six months. You may also conduct a thorough cleaning on occasion.

These scooters are also often less expensive than standard-sized models. This is partly because they tend to have a smaller frame and lighter components. They also have fewer features like headlights or speedometers, which can increase the price.

The models with the lowest prices are typically less than $250, whereas others can approach $500. Some retailers offer free shipping to help lower the cost even more. Some companies also have flexible warranty and return policies, although they differ from retailer to retailer.

Whatever their cost All of these scooters have been rigorously checked for stability and safety. You can choose between automatic and manual models. These fold and unfold at the touch of a button or by releasing levers and knobs. This could make the process much simpler for some users who might be unable to knee or bent required by other aids to mobility.

Another important factor to consider when selecting a foldable mobility scooter is the weight. The lighter the scooter is, the easier it will be to fold it and fit into your vehicle or trunk. It also has a positive impact on performance, such as speed, max climbing angles and lifting speed.
